— WHAT IS SUCTION PUMP CALIBRATION —
Imagine an operating theatre where a suction unit is delivering 20% less vacuum than its dial indicates — airway clearance during surgery becomes unreliable at the exact moment it matters most. A miscalibrated suction pump puts patient safety at direct risk.
Suction pump calibration compares the regulated vacuum level and flow rate of an aspiration unit against NPL-traceable vacuum references at multiple set points. Deviations are documented, the regulator adjusted where possible, and a NABL certificate issued confirming ISO 10079 compliance — accepted by NABH and ISO 13485 auditors.
Check
Vacuum level and flow rate tested at multiple set points against NPL-traceable vacuum reference.
Correct
Regulator and relief-valve adjustment performed; correction table issued where adjustment isn't possible.
Certify
NABL CC-2480 certificate issued with full as-found/as-left data and uncertainty statement.
— INSTRUMENTS COVERED —
Surgical, portable, and regulated vacuum aspiration systems across all makes and models.
Electric surgical aspirators calibrated for negative-pressure (vacuum) accuracy and regulated suction performance.
Vacuum regulator and gauge calibration at multiple set points against NPL-traceable vacuum reference.
Suction flow rate (L/min) measured at defined vacuum levels and compared to manufacturer-stated performance.
Regulator valve linearity, overflow protector, and pressure-relief function tested across the full operating range.
— OUR PROCESS —
Pump body, collection jar, tubing, overflow protector, filter, and switch inspected — incoming condition documented as-found.
Outlet blocked and pump run to measure maximum achievable vacuum using NABL-traceable vacuum reference gauge.
Pump set to regulated vacuum levels (e.g. -20, -40, -60, -80 kPa). Actual vacuum measured at each point and deviations recorded.
Suction flow rate measured at defined vacuum levels. Regulator adjusted where permitted; correction table issued otherwise.
Post-adjustment vacuum and flow readings verified at all points per ISO 10079. Expanded uncertainty calculated per ISO/IEC 17025.
NABL CC-2480 certificate with as-found/as-left data, uncertainty (k=2), and ISO 10079 traceability issued within 24 hours.
